Miles Taylor, who served as chief of staff at the Department of Homeland Security during Trump's first term, tore into the administration's handling of its relationship with Canada in a new Substack post.

"Canada is demonstrating, for every democracy watching, that the response to Trump’s bullying should be neither submission nor hysteria… but the calm construction of alternatives," he wrote. "Our allies aren’t leaving because they hate America. They’re leaving because they miss us, and they can’t stand the bully who’s holding us hostage."
